本文分类:news发布日期:2024/11/16 4:33:42
相关文章
十分钟Linux中的epoll机制
epoll机制
epoll是Linux内核提供的一种高效I/O事件通知机制,用于处理大量文件描述符的I/O操作。它适合高并发场景,如网络服务器、实时数据处理等,是select和poll的高效替代方案。
1. epoll的工作原理
epoll通过内核中的事件通知接口和文件…
建站知识
2024/11/13 0:01:21
AcWing 1069 凸多边形的划分 区间dp + 高精度
代码
#include <bits/stdc.h>using namespace std;const int N 55, M 35;typedef long long LL;int n;
LL temp[M], w[N];
LL f[N][N][M];void mul(LL a[], LL b)
{LL t 0;for (int i 0; i < M; i ){t a[i] * b;a[i] t % 10;t / 10;}
}void add(LL a[], LL b[…
建站知识
2024/11/13 11:02:38
C++ 模板专题 - 静态分支(if)
一:概述: 模板元编程(Template Metaprogramming,简称 TMP)是一种在 C 中使用模板进行编程的技术,它允许在编译时执行计算、生成代码,提供类似脚本语言的功能。TMP 常用于生成高效的代码…
建站知识
2024/11/13 17:15:54
支持向量机SVM简述
支持向量机SVM
1、概述
SVM全称是supported vector machine(支持向量机),即寻找到一个超平面使样本分成两类,并且间隔最大。
SVM 模型有3种:
线性可分支持向量机:适用于训练数据线性可分。线性支持向量…
建站知识
2024/11/15 21:50:52
如何去掉idea的Usage提示
最近更新新版本的idea之后,我发现编辑代码时多了一个usages的提示信息,本来我想在提示所在行添加注释,但这个usages总是会让我难以选择位置,因此我想关掉这个提示。
解决办法
在setting中找到如下设置,勾选掉Usages即…
建站知识
2024/11/13 23:04:40
PAT甲级-1074 Reversing Linked List
题目 题目大意
给一个链表的头结点和总节点个数,以及k。每k个节点的链表都要翻转。
思路
链表可以用一个结构体数组来存储,先遍历一遍,过滤掉不在链表中的节点。然后将过滤好的节点放入res数组中,每k个元素用一次reverse()&…
建站知识
2024/11/14 9:01:35
学习算力网络必会关键词
算力网络(Computility Network) 算力网络是以算为中心、网为根基,网、云、数、智、安、边、端、链(ABCD-NETS)等深度融合、提供一体化服务的新型信息基础设施。算力网络的目标是实现“算力泛在、算网共生、智能编排、一…
建站知识
2024/11/14 8:57:33
Java 多线程(九)—— JUC 常见组件 与 线程安全的集合类
Callable 与 FutureTask
Callable 接口和 Runnable 接口是并列关系,都是用来给线程提供任务的,只不过 Callable 接口的任务可以带有返回值。 但是 Callable 接口创建的任务不能直接传入 Thread 里面,这也是为了 解耦合,我们可以使…
建站知识
2024/11/15 21:05:26